ACK DRAPER bullied Brazilian Joao Fonseca out of the French Open to stay on collision course to meet Jannik Sinner in the last eight.
Teenager Fonseca has been tipped as a future superstar — and Mats Wilander claimed that the world No.65 could join the Italian and Carlos Alcaraz in a new Big Three.
But Draper yesterday showed he is the player most likely to threaten the world’s top two as he gave the 18-year-old a harsh lesson.
Foneseca has a fearsome but wild forehand and the rest of his young game has still to mature. And Draper mixed drop shots — which his opponent usually did not chase — with looping groundstrokes to break his rhythm and his spirit.
Long before the end the flummoxed Flamengo fan was looking up to his player box in confusion as Draper won 6-2 6-4 6-2 in one hour and 46 minutes. This hyped encounter started in drizzle and ended as a damp squib.
It was man against boy.
